Construction of precision clinical-proteomics risk model based on machine learning for predicting heart failure in type II diabetes mellitus.

BACKGROUND AND AIMS: Heart failure (HF) is a severe complication in type 2 diabetes mellitus (T2DM), but current risk stratification scores have limited predictive accuracy. We aimed to develop novel prediction tools integrating clinical variables with proteomics to improve risk stratification of hospitalization for HF in T2DM. METHODS AND RESULTS: In this study, we included 2111 UK Biobank participants with T2DM but no prior HF, and profiled 2920 proteins to predict 10-year incident HF hospitalization. Participants were randomly divided into training (70%), tuning (10%), and validation (20%) sets.Three prediction models were developed: a Clinical model based on demographic characteristics, comorbidities, medication use, and laboratory indices; a Protein model based on 40 proteins selected by the Light Gradient Boosting Machine (LGBM); and the Clinical OMics and Protein ASSessment for Heart Failure (COMPASS-HF) model, which integrated both clinical variables and the LGBM-selected proteins. Models were evaluated for area under the curve (AUC), sensitivity, and specificity. During follow-up, 168 participants (7.96%) developed incident HF. The COMPASS-HF model showed better discrimination than the Clinical model, with an AUC of 0.897 (95% CI: 0.850-0.945) versus 0.790 (95% CI: 0.723-0.856). It also demonstrated higher sensitivity (0.882; 95% CI: 0.725-0.967) and consistent performance in subgroups. COMPASS-HF effectively stratified risk of hospitalization for HF, with cumulative incidence rates of 31.9% in the high-risk group and 1.2% in the low-risk group. CONCLUSIONS: By combining clinical and proteomic variables, we developed a high-performance HF prediction model for T2DM, enabling precise risk stratification and informing early intervention strategies.

A systematic approach to standardizing the visual appearance of endometriotic lesions for artificial intelligence recognition.

INTRODUCTION: Numerous studies have shown that the diagnostic performance and reproducibility of visual recognition of endometriosis during laparoscopy are poor. The use of artificial intelligence (AI) seems relevant for exhaustive lesion recognition. Standardization of the visual classification of lesions, in the form of an ontology, is an essential prerequisite to enable medical experts to annotate surgical data consistently and subsequently allow engineers to train and build an artificial intelligence tool for endometriosis recognition. MATERIAL AND METHODS: A systematic search was conducted in the MEDLINE (via PubMed), EMBASE, and the Cochrane Library databases up to May 2022, aiming to identify studies describing the laparoscopic visual appearance of superficial endometriosis, endometriomas, and deep infiltrating endometriosis. The accumulated data in the literature concerning the visual appearance of the different forms of endometriosis were used to create an ontology that could be used for artificial intelligence applications. RESULTS: Out of 932 articles screened, 35 studies were selected based on the inclusion criteria of human subjects with histologically confirmed endometriosis lesions visualized via laparoscopy. The selected studies were reviewed to develop a visual ontology of endometriosis lesions observed via laparoscopy. The lesions were categorized into 4 classes and further subdivided into 11 subclasses: superficial (black, red, white, or subtle), adhesions (dense or filmy), deep (obliteration, retraction, or deformation), and ovarian (endometrioma or chocolate fluid). The positive predictive value (PPV) varied across lesion types: black lesions (PPV 47%-97%), red lesions (PPV 33%-100%), white lesions (PPV 20%-81%), and ovarian endometriosis (PPV 42%-98%). Nonspecific lesions such as adhesions (PPV 16%-50%) and subtle superficial lesions (PPV 0%-67%) presented lower PPVs. Deep endometriosis lesions, often buried within organs, required indirect signs (obliteration, retraction, deformation) for identification. CONCLUSIONS: The visual ontology proposed in this systematic search could facilitate the detection and classification of endometriosis lesions using artificial intelligence. This study highlights the challenges of reaching a consensus on lesion recognition and classification in AI projects due to the diverse visual presentations of endometriosis.

Effects of adjunctive bifrontal tDCS on depressive symptoms and cognitive performance in major depressive disorder: A randomized, double-blind, sham-controlled crossover pilot study.

BACKGROUND: Evidence for antidepressant effects of transcranial direct current stimulation (tDCS) in major depressive disorder (MDD) is heterogeneous, and cognitive effects remain uncertain. We compared depressive symptoms and DSST performance during active and sham bifrontal tDCS in medicated outpatients with MDD and baseline HAMD-17 &#x2265; 15. METHODS: In this randomized, double-blind, sham-controlled crossover pilot trial, adults with MDD and inadequate response to an adequate antidepressant trial were assigned to active&#x2192;sham or sham&#x2192;active tDCS sequences while continuing antidepressants. Each period comprised 10 sessions over 2 weeks. Active stimulation was delivered at 2 mA for 20 min (anode F3, cathode F4); sham used the same montage with brief ramping only. No washout interval was used. No washout interval was used. The primary outcome was HAMD-17; secondary outcomes were DSST and CGI ratings. RESULTS: Of 38 randomized participants, 32 completed both periods and were analyzed per protocol. HAMD-17 scores were lower during active than sham stimulation (mean difference -3.63, 95% CI -5.86 to -1.40; p = 0.002), but the condition-by-sequence interaction was significant (p = 0.026). No condition effect was observed for DSST (p = 0.261) or CGI-Severity (p = 1.000); CGI-Improvement was strongly sequence-dependent (p < 0.001). In an exploratory first-period analysis, adjusted T1 HAMD-17 scores were lower in the active-first group (adjusted difference -4.90, 95% CI -7.92 to -1.87; p = 0.003). Adverse effects were mild and transient. CONCLUSIONS: Active tDCS was associated with lower HAMD-17 scores, but the pooled contrast was order-dependent and cannot be interpreted as a definitive treatment effect. No DSST benefit was observed.

Effectiveness of a digi-physical tool and working method for paediatric obesity treatment in Abu Dhabi: a non-inferiority intervention study using an external historical comparator.

BACKGROUND: Effective paediatric obesity treatment requires high intensity, scalable interventions. A digi-physical tool for paediatric obesity treatment has shown positive results in Stockholm, Sweden. This study evaluates whether the same treatment method is effective in a different cultural setting. METHODS: This non-inferiority intervention study, using an external historical comparator, included 60 consecutively recruited children aged 6-15.9 years with obesity who initiated treatment at Sheikh Shakhbout Medical City in Abu Dhabi between June and December 2023. Patients were treated with Evira, a digi-physical tool and working method enabling high intensity individualized care, real-time monitoring, and interactive patient-clinician communication. The primary outcome was BMI z-score change at 26 weeks. Non-inferiority was assessed using a predefined margin of 0.10 BMI z-score, with outcomes compared to a prior published trial in Stockholm (n&#x2009;=&#x2009;107). RESULTS: A total of 112 children were included in the analysis (Abu Dhabi cohort, n&#x2009;=&#x2009;35; Stockholm cohort, n&#x2009;=&#x2009;77). The adjusted mean change in BMI z-score was -&#x2009;0.20 (95% CI: -&#x2009;0.28, -&#x2009;0.12) in the Abu Dhabi cohort and -&#x2009;0.20 (- 0.26, -&#x2009;0.14) in the Stockholm cohort (p&#x2009;=&#x2009;0.88). Non-inferiority was confirmed, (predefined margin 0.10 was not exceeded). A clinically significant BMI z-score reduction (&#x2265;&#x2009;0.20 units) was achieved by 45.7% of participants in Abu Dhabi and 36.4% in Stockholm (p&#x2009;=&#x2009;0.35). Non-retention rates at 26 weeks were 41.7% vs. 28.0%, respectively (p&#x2009;=&#x2009;0.07). CONCLUSIONS: The findings provide promising evidence that treatment outcomes achieved with the digi-physical treatment tool were comparable in the Abu Dhabi and Stockholm cohorts, supporting its feasibility in a second cultural and healthcare setting.

A bimodal large language model reduces misalignment in patient education: A double-blinded randomized trial.

BACKGROUND: Effective patient education requires accurate communication aligned with patients' emotional and semantical needs. Text-based large language models (LLMs) lack access to non-verbal cues, which may contribute to misaligned responses. METHODS: We evaluated emotional and semantic misalignment in a text-based LLM using 64,200 utterances from 16,583 patient education cases across six departments and three centers. Dolphin was developed integrating text and audio cues and evaluated through emotion recognition, semantic consistency assessment, branch-level ablations, and a double-blinded randomized trial against a matched text-based LLM comparator (Chinese Clinical Trial Registry: (ChiCTR2500095933). FINDINGS: The text-based LLM showed emotional misalignment in 36.7% of responses and semantic misalignment in 28.3% of cases, with higher misalignment under greater burden. Dolphin outperformed the text-based LLM in emotion recognition accuracy (0.886 vs. 0.713) and semantic consistency (84.9% vs. 82.1%; both adjusted p < 0.001). Ablations supported contribution of audio branches. Dolphin received higher expert ratings than the text-based LLM and human educators (all p < 0.001). In 555 patients, Dolphin was associated with greater patient satisfaction (98.6% vs. 93.8%), suggestion acceptance (76.1% vs. 58.9%; p < 0.001), proactive disclosure (44.6% vs. 26.5%; p < 0.001), and fewer 7-day unplanned recontact (12.9% vs. 22.9%; p = 0.002). No unsafe recommendations or safety events were identified. CONCLUSIONS: Compared with text-based LLM, Dolphin improved emotional-semantic alignment and patient-education outcomes, supporting bimodal alignment as a strategy for reducing misalignment-driven communication failures. Posterior Segment Risk Factors for Penetrating Keratoplasty Failure.

PURPOSE: To analyze the relationship between intraoperative and postpenetrating keratoplasty (PK) posterior segment variables and PK graft survival. DESIGN: Retrospective clinical cohort study. SUBJECTS: Patients undergoing PK between May 1, 2007 and September 1, 2018 at a single tertiary center. METHODS: Chart review for PKs performed was conducted, and the first PK completed at the institution for each patient was included for analysis. Data collected included demographics, medical and ocular history, preoperative and intraoperative findings, and intraoperative and postoperative posterior segment factors (pars plana vitrectomy [PPV], endolaser, retinal detachment [RD], and vitreous hemorrhage [VH]). After univariable analysis, variables were selected for multivariable Cox regression analysis. MAIN OUTCOME MEASURE: Graft failure, defined as irreversible and visually significant corneal edema, haze, or scarring. RESULTS: Eight hundred and thirty-five eyes of 835 patients were included. Mean age was 57.1 &#xb1; 22.0 (range: 0-100) years, and mean time from PK to final follow-up or graft failure was 3.2 &#xb1; 2.9 (range: 0.01-16.1) years. Graft failure occurred in 35.0% of cases with a mean onset of 1.9 &#xb1; 2.0 (range: 0.04-11.4) years after PK. After multivariable analysis, 9 variables had significant associations with failure. Two posterior segment variables were significant: intraoperative VH at the time of PK (hazard ratio [HR] 6.6, 95% confidence interval [CI] 1.6-27.7, P = .010) and silicone oil (SO) tamponade after the PK (HR 3.2, 95% CI 1.4-7.4, P = .007). CONCLUSIONS: Graft failure is a serious complication of PK. VH at the time of the PK and SO tamponade after the PK were associated with graft failure. In complex eyes that are undergoing PK grafts and that may also require posterior segment interventions, these findings may guide patient counseling and discussion of graft prognosis.

Low-carbohydrate diet score subtypes and all-cause mortality in general and chronic disease populations: a systematic review and meta-analysis of prospective cohort studies.

OBJECTIVES: To examine associations of overall, healthy and unhealthy low-carbohydrate diet (LCD) scores with all-cause mortality in general and chronic disease populations. Healthy and unhealthy subtypes were compared with assess whether the observed associations depend on macronutrient quality rather than carbohydrate restriction alone. DESIGN: Systematic review and pairwise category meta-analysis. DATA SOURCES: PubMed, MEDLINE, ProQuest Medical Database and Web of Science Core Collection were searched from inception to 12 May 2026. ELIGIBILITY CRITERIA: Prospective cohort studies of adults assessing LCD adherence using a validated three-macronutrient composite score and reporting HRs for all-cause mortality were eligible. DATA EXTRACTION AND SYNTHESIS: Two reviewers independently extracted data and assessed study quality using the Newcastle-Ottawa Scale (NOS). Random-effects meta-analyses compared each higher reported LCD category with the lowest category, stratified by LCD score subtype and population type. Certainty of evidence was assessed using NutriGrade. RESULTS: 18 prospective cohort studies included 779&#x2009;158 participants and 219&#x2009;457 deaths; all scored 7-9/9 on the NOS. In chronic disease populations, the highest healthy LCD category was associated with lower mortality than the lowest category (HR 0.72, 95%&#x2009;CI 0.69 to 0.76; I&#xb2;=0%; high certainty), as was the highest overall LCD category (HR 0.85, 95%&#x2009;CI 0.75 to 0.96; I&#xb2;=68%; high certainty). In the general population, the highest healthy LCD category was not associated with lower mortality than the lowest category (HR 0.93, 95%&#x2009;CI 0.85 to 1.01; I&#xb2;=69%; moderate certainty), and neither was the highest overall LCD category (HR 0.96, 95%&#x2009;CI 0.90 to 1.03; I&#xb2;=87%; low certainty). Unhealthy LCD scores were not associated with mortality in either population. CONCLUSIONS: Healthy LCD adherence was associated with lower all-cause mortality, particularly among individuals with chronic diseases. Unhealthy LCD scores were not associated with mortality in either population, suggesting that macronutrient quality and source may matter more than carbohydrate reduction alone.

Understanding and Usefulness of Effect Size and Certainty of Evidence: A Cross-Sectional Survey of Evidence-Based Practice Competencies Among US Registered Dietitians.

INTRODUCTION: Understanding of absolute and relative effect estimates, and determining effect size and certainty of evidence corresponding to effect estimates, represent fundamental evidence-based practice competencies that promote informed clinical decision-making. While research has been conducted in the medical profession, based on our literature review there is no published research on these competencies in the nutrition and dietetics profession. METHODS: Among registered dietitians, our main objectives were to assess (1) their understanding and perceived usefulness of three absolute and two relative effect estimate approaches to determine effect size, (2) their perceived usefulness of certainty of evidence, and (3) factors influencing their understanding and perceived usefulness. We conducted a web-based, cross-sectional survey by recruiting dietitians from the Academy of Nutrition and Dietetics (United States). Participants received effect estimates based on hypothetical dietary interventions vs. usual diet for reducing myocardial infarction risk. RESULTS: Of the 11,050 dietitians who received the survey link, 210 participated, and only completers (n&#x2009;=&#x2009;114) were included in our analysis. Participants demonstrated a similar understanding of the relative (27.6%) and absolute (27.5%) effect estimates, with Risk Difference being the best understood approach and Number Needed to Treat being the least (30.7% vs. 24.6% correct responses). While perceived usefulness scores were similar between five approaches, they were highest when data was presented as Relative Risk [mean (SD): 4.82 (1.50)]. Dietitians rated the usefulness of certainty of evidence favorably [mean (SD): 5.07 (1.83), on a 7-point scale], and no factors were associated with correct understanding. CONCLUSION: Dietitians may have limited understanding of effect size thresholds presented in our survey, a finding mostly consistent with surveys of other health professionals. To optimize informed decision-making between dietitians and clients, dietetic programs and continuing education platforms should consider additional training on effect estimate approaches (relative and absolute), and determining effect sizes and certainty of evidence for effect estimates.

Evaluating a culturally adapted question prompt list to improve end-of-life communication among indonesian migrant caregivers: A randomized controlled trial with qualitative insights.

OBJECTIVE: Indonesian caregivers serve as essential providers of end-of-life (EOL) care in Taiwan. But often face communication challenges due to language, cultural, and hierarchical barriers. This study evaluated the effectiveness of a culturally adapted Question Prompt List (QPL). METHODS: This study employed a two-arm randomized controlled trial design supplemented with qualitative interviews. The study was conducted in a hospice ward and home care setting within a medical center in Taiwan. A total of sixty Indonesian caregivers were recruited and randomly assigned to either the intervention group (n&#x202f;=&#x202f;30) or the control group (n&#x202f;=&#x202f;30). The intervention group received routine end-of-life (EOL) education along with a culturally adapted Question Prompt List (QPL), which consisted of 37 items covering domains including the dying process, emotional support, communication, symptom management, and care decision-making. The control group received routine EOL education. Outcome measures included caregiving preparedness, communication self-efficacy, satisfaction, and question-asking behavior. In addition, semi-structured interviews were conducted with eight participants, and the data were analyzed using thematic content analysis. RESULTS: Analysis of covariance revealed no statistically significant between-group differences in caregiving preparedness (F = 1.58, p&#x202f;=&#x202f;.215 [-0.41, 0.44]) or communication selfefficacy (F = 0.83, p&#x202f;=&#x202f;.366 [-0.44, 0.79]). However, communication satisfaction was significantly higher in the intervention group (F = 4.19, p&#x202f;<&#x202f;.05 [0.04, 0.44]). The number of questions asked was also significantly higher in the intervention group (t&#x202f;=&#x202f;-4.35, p&#x202f;<&#x202f;.001 [-5.41, -1.98]). Thematic analysis of qualitative data identified 4 themes and 14 subthemes, illustrating how the QPL reduced anxiety, clarified care needs, and improved confidence. CONCLUSIONS: A culturally adapted QPL can enhance communication engagement and satisfaction among migrant caregivers. PRACTICE IMPLICATIONS: Integrating culturally tailored QPLs into caregiver education and palliative care practice may promote more inclusive and effective communication.

Longitudinal comparison of treat-to-target states and clinical outcomes in patients with late-onset versus early-onset systemic lupus erythematosus.

OBJECTIVE: We compared demographic and clinical characteristics between patients with late-onset (LO) and early-onset (EO) systemic lupus erythematosus (SLE) and examined their longitudinal associations with treatment targets and long-term outcomes, irreversible organ damage accrual and health-related quality of life (HRQoL). METHODS: We analyzed prospectively collected data from patients enrolled in the Asia Pacific Lupus Collaboration cohort. Patients diagnosed with SLE at age >50 years were classified as LO-SLE and compared with those diagnosed at age &#x2264;50 years (EO-SLE). Longitudinal associations with treatment targets (LLDAS and DORIS remission), organ damage accrual (SLICC/ACR Damage Index), and HRQoL (SF36v2 physical and mental component summary (PCS and MCS) scores) were examined using multivariable multilevel logistic, recurrent-event survival, and linear mixed-effects models, respectively. Disease activity, flares, medication exposure, and other clinical characteristics were also compared between groups. RESULTS: Among 3,917 patients studied, 346 (8.8%) had LO-SLE. Compared with EO-SLE, patients with LO-SLE had lower disease activity, lower glucocorticoid and immunosuppressant exposure, and higher attainment of treatment targets; LO-SLE was associated with higher odds of attaining LLDAS (OR: 2.33 (1.66, 3.28)) and DORIS remission (OR: 2.22 (1.45, 3.38)). However, they were at a greater risk of damage accrual (HR:1.82 (1.50, 2.21)) and lower PCS scores, meaning poorer physical health (regression coefficient (RC) = -3.63 (-4.58, -2.68)) but not MCS (RC= 0.68 (-.50, 1.86)). CONCLUSION: Despite higher attainment of treatment targets, patients with LO-SLE experienced greater damage accrual and poorer physical health, suggesting that disease activity targets alone may not fully capture outcome risk in LO-SLE.

Comparative efficacy and safety of bi-flanged metal stents versus lumen-apposing metal stents for endoscopic drainage of pancreatic fluid collections: a systematic review and meta-analysis.

INTRODUCTION: Pancreatic fluid collections (PFCs), particularly walled-off necrosis, are common complications of acute pancreatitis that often require endoscopic drainage. Bi-flanged metal stents (BFMS; NAGI; Taewoong Medical, Gyenoggi-do, Korea) and electrocautery-enhanced lumen-apposing metal stents (LAMS; AXIOS, Boston Scientific Corporation, Marlborough, Massachusetts, USA) are frequently used, but comparative data remain limited. This study aims to compare the efficacy and safety of BFMS and LAMS in the endoscopic drainage of PFCs. METHODS: This meta-analysis followed the Cochrane Handbook for Systematic Reviews of Interventions and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Comprehensive database searches were conducted through November 2024 to identify studies comparing BFMS and LAMS for endoscopic ultrasound-guided drainage of PFCs. Outcomes were pooled using a random-effects model with RevMan Web, and statistical significance was defined as a P value less than 0.05. RESULTS: Three studies ( n &#x2005;=&#x2005;627; 329 BFMS and 298 LAMS) met inclusion criteria. No significant differences were observed between BFMS and LAMS for technical success [odds ratio (OR): 1.16; 95% confidence interval (CI): 0.55-2.43] or clinical success (OR: 0.97; 95% CI: 0.51-1.87). Similarly, there were no differences in walled-off necrosis recurrence (OR: 2.01; 95% CI: 0.17-24.02), number of direct endoscopic necrosectomy sessions (OR: 0.52; 95% CI: 0.05-5.12), or mean number of endoscopic procedures (mean difference: 0.18, 95% CI: 2.08-2.45). Adverse events were also comparable between groups, including bleeding (OR: 0.64), infection (OR: 1.18), stent migration (OR: 1.83), and stent occlusion/dysfunction (OR: 1.71). CONCLUSION: BFMS and LAMS provide equivalent efficacy and safety in the endoscopic ultrasound-guided drainage of PFCs. Either stent type represents a viable therapeutic option. Further large-scale prospective studies are warranted to refine stent selection strategies.

Safety of a quadrivalent meningococcal conjugate vaccine (MenACYW-TT) administered concomitantly with routine pediatric vaccines in healthy infants and toddlers in USA and Puerto Rico: Results from a Phase III, randomized, active-controlled study.

MenACYW-TT, a quadrivalent meningococcal tetanus toxoid-conjugate vaccine, is approved for prevention of invasive meningococcal disease in infants&#x2009;&#x2265;&#x2009;6&#x2009;weeks of age in the USA. This Phase III study (NCT03673462; September 17, 2018 - March 16, 2023) evaluated the safety of MenACYW-TT compared with a licensed quadrivalent meningococcal oligosaccharide diphtheria CRM197-conjugate vaccine (MenACWY-CRM) when administered concomitantly with routine pediatric vaccines in healthy infants and toddlers in a four-dose series (3+1 schedule). Participants were randomized 3:1 to receive MenACYW-TT (Group 1; n&#x2009;=&#x2009;2080) or MenACWY-CRM (Group 2; n&#x2009;=&#x2009;697) at 2, 4, 6, and 12&#x2009;months of age, with concomitant administration of routine pediatric vaccines (DTaP5-IPV/Hib, PCV13, rotavirus, hepatitis B, MMR, and varicella vaccines). Safety assessments included immediate unsolicited adverse events within 30&#x2009;minutes post-vaccination, solicited injection site and systemic reactions within 7d, unsolicited AEs within 30d, serious adverse events (SAEs) including adverse events of special interest (AESIs), and medically attended adverse events (MAAEs) throughout the study. MenACYW-TT and MenACWY-CRM were overall well tolerated, and safety profiles were comparable. Solicited injection site reactions occurred in 84.9% and 84.6% of participants in Groups 1 and 2, respectively; solicited systemic reactions in 87.1% and 88.2%, respectively. During the entire study, 5.2% in Group 1 and 3.0% in Group 2 experienced at least one SAE; 0.9% and 0.1%, respectively, reported at least one AESI. Three deaths occurred in Group 1. All SAEs, AESIs, and deaths were unrelated to study vaccines. This study supports the safety profile of MenACYW-TT in infants and toddlers aged&#x2009;&#x2265;&#x2009;6&#x2009;weeks.Study registration: Clinicaltrials.gov: NCT03673462; EudraCT: 2019-004459-35.

Vesicoureteral reflux and anorectal malformations.

BACKGROUND: Renal and urinary tract anomalies are frequently associated with anorectal malformations (ARMs) and may adversely affect long-term renal outcomes, if not detected early. However, reliable clinical predictors for significant urologic abnormalities across different ARM phenotypes remain poorly defined. OBJECTIVE: To determine the prevalence and grade distribution of vesicoureteric reflux (VUR) in neonates with ARMs, and to explore its association with renal and urinary tract anomalies, the complexity of the ARM phenotype, and other factors are associated with high-grade VUR. METHODS: In this retrospective cross-sectional study, medical records of 64 neonates diagnosed with ARMs and managed at a tertiary children's hospital between 2018 and 2025 were reviewed. All patients underwent renal and urinary tract ultrasonography. Voiding cystourethrography (VCUG) was performed for all neonates according to our institutional protocol, regardless of ultrasound findings or ARM phenotype. Demographic characteristics, ARM phenotype (less-complex vs. complex), urologic findings, urinary tract infection (UTI) history, and associated anomalies were analyzed. Multivariable logistic regression models were used to identify independent predictors of complex ARM phenotype and high-grade VUR. RESULTS: The cohort consisted of 64 neonates (75% male) with a mean gestational age of 37.36 &#xb1; 1.83 weeks and a mean birth weight of 2940 &#xb1; 601 g. Renal and urinary tract anomalies were common, with hydronephrosis observed in 48.4%, VUR of any grade in 39.1% and hydroureter in 35.9%,of patients. High-grade VUR was identified in 21.9% of patients, and a documented history of UTI was present in 18.8% of the entire cohort. In multivariable analyses, birth weight, presence of VUR, and UTI history were not independently associated with complex ARM phenotype. Additionally, no demographic or clinical variables reliably predicted high-grade VUR. The predictive performance of the regression model for high-grade VUR was limited (AUC = 0.60). CONCLUSION: Renal and urinary tract anomalies are highly prevalent among neonates with ARMs, with VUR representing a prominent finding. The lack of robust clinical predictors for complex ARM phenotype or high-grade VUR underscores the limitations of selective screening strategies and supports the role of comprehensive urologic evaluation in neonates with ARM, regardless of anatomic subtype.

Could the preoperative urethral curve be used to predict immediate urinary continence following Retzius-sparing robot-assisted radical prostatectomy? A retrospective multi-center study.

PURPOSE: Immediate urinary continence (UC) recovery following Retzius-sparing robot-assisted radical prostatectomy (RS-RARP) remains highly variable, highlighting the need for reliable preoperative prediction. We aimed to develop and validate models to identify patients likely to achieve immediate UC recovery following RS-RARP. MATERIALS AND METHODS: A total of 580 prostate cancer patients who underwent RS-RARP from four medical centers were assigned to a training set (n=348), an internal validation set (n=103) and an external validation set (n=129). Independent predictors were identified through univariate analysis and LASSO regression. A nomogram was constructed using multivariate logistic regression. Its performance was evaluated with receiver operating characteristic (ROC) curve, calibration curves, and decision curve analysis. RESULTS: Immediate UC recovery was observed in 84.5% (294/348) of patients in the training cohort, 80.6% (83/103) in the internal validation cohort, and 81.4% (105/129) in the external validation cohort, respectively. Multivariate analysis identified membranous urethral length (MUL) (OR=1.23, P=0.029) and urethral curvature (OR=2.84, P<0.001) as independent predictors, while prostate volume (PV) (OR=0.84, P <0.001) as a protective factor. The nomogram integrating MUL, PV, and urethral curvature demonstrated superior predictive accuracy, with an AUC of 0.87 (95% CI, 0.83-0.91) in the training cohort. The bootstrap-corrected calibration slope was 0.96, and the Brier score was 0.08.&#xa0;Calibration curves and decision curve analysis confirmed the predictive accuracy and clinical utility of the nomogram. CONCLUSIONS: Our study introduces a novel quantitative method for assessing urethral curvature. The mpMRI-based model, integrating urethral curvature and prostate spatial configuration, offers enhanced predictive accuracy for postoperative immediate UC recovery.

Psychotherapy vs antidepressants in heart failure: Impact of adherence.

BACKGROUND: Depression affects nearly half of patients with heart failure (HF), which is associated with increased morbidity and reduced health-related quality of life (HRQoL). This secondary per-protocol analysis of a previously published randomized trial evaluated the behavioral activation (BA) versus antidepressant medication (MEDS) among patients with depression and HF who adhered to study interventions. METHODS: This analysis is based on a pragmatic randomized comparative-effectiveness trial conducted from 2018 to 2022, with a 1-year follow-up. 416 participants diagnosed with HF and a DSM-5 depressive disorder were randomized to BA or MEDS, and the current analysis examined outcomes according to treatment adherence. OUTCOMES: The primary outcome was depressive symptom severity (PHQ-9) at 6&#xa0;months, and the secondary outcomes were physical and mental HRQoL (SF-12v2-PC and SF-12v2-MC, respectively) and HF-specific HRQoL (Kansas City Cardiomyopathy Questionnaire; KCCQ) overall and clinical scores (KCCQ-OS and KCCQ-CS), at 3, 6, and 12&#xa0;months. High adherence was defined as completion of >75-100% of intervention components. Overall adherence rates were similar between BA and MEDS. At 6&#xa0;months, among patients with >75-100% adherence who followed treatment as directed in both arms, BA was associated with higher Mental HRQoL (SF-12v2-MC: 5.22; 95% CI: 0.72 to 9.72; p&#xa0;=&#xa0;0.023) and higher HF-specific HRQoL (KCCQ-OS: 16.08; 95% CI: 7.20 to 24.97; p&#xa0;<&#xa0;0.001); (KCCQ-CS: 16.04; 95%CI: 7.05 to 25.02; p&#xa0;<&#xa0;0.001) compared to MEDS. There were no significant differences in depressive symptoms or physical HRQoL at 6&#xa0;months. INTERPRETATION: Both BA and MEDS were equally effective treatments for depression in HF. However, among highly adherent patients, BA was associated with greater improvements in mental and HF-specific HRQoL than MEDS. Efficacy of citicoline as an add-on therapy in Parkinson's disease: a randomized, double-blind trial.

BACKGROUND: Citicoline is a promising therapeutic option for improving both motor and non-motor symptoms in Parkinson's disease (PD) beyond levodopa and other standard dopaminergic treatments. OBJECTIVES: The CITIPARK study evaluated the efficacy and safety of citicoline in improving clinical outcomes and quality of life (QOL) in PD patients on dopaminergic therapies. METHODS: The randomized, double-blind, multicenter trial compared citicoline (1000&#x202f;mg/day intramuscular, two six-week cycles) with placebo for 24 weeks in PD under stable medications. The primary endpoint was change in Movement Disorder Society-Unified PD Rating Scale (MDS-UPDRS) total score; secondary endpoints included motor and non-motor subscores, QOL, clinical global impression (CGI) and safety. RESULTS: The study enrolled 485 participants, randomizing 474 (citicoline: 303; placebo: 171). Citicoline significantly increased the likelihood of achieving a minimal clinically important difference compared with placebo (OR 2.06, 95% CI 1.06-3.99; P&#x202f;=&#x202f;0.031) on the MDS-UDPRS total score in the modified intention-to-treat population. Among secondary outcomes, the citicoline group showed greater improvement in motor function (MDS-UPDRS III -2.97 vs -0.13; p&#x202f;=&#x202f;0.009) and a greater improvement on CGI -II and CGI-III (3.26 vs 3.59; p&#x202f;=&#x202f;0.021 and 9.30 vs 10.38; p&#x202f;=&#x202f;0.018, respectively). AEs occurred in 22.1% and 27.1% of the citicoline and placebo groups, respectively. CONCLUSIONS: Citicoline was well tolerated and associated with motor benefits compared with placebo in a highly compliant population. The results suggest a role of citicoline as a safe and possibly effective supportive therapy in PD treated with concomitant dopaminergic agents.

Proficiency-based training and evidence-based methodology: a systematic review and meta-analysis.

OBJECTIVE: To assess adherence of self-labelled proficiency-based progression (PBP) studies to evidence-based PBP criteria and examine associations with training outcomes. METHODS: A systematic review and meta-analysis were conducted according to the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ines and registered in the International Prospective Register of Systematic Reviews. PubMed, CENTRAL, EMBASE, MEDLINE, and Scopus were searched from inception to 1 March 2023. Prospective English-language studies on healthcare procedural training reporting objective performance outcomes were included; non-prospective, non-quantitative, non-procedural, non-English studies, and reviews were excluded. Pre-specified outcomes included adherence to 18 evidence-based PBP criteria and objective performance metrics (errors, steps, time); secondary outcomes included proficiency benchmark achievement and Likert ratings. Data extraction was performed independently by multiple reviewers. Study quality was assessed using the Medical Education Research Study Quality Instrument and risk of bias by two investigators. Effect sizes were pooled using random-effects models (DerSimonian-Laird), expressed as the ratio of means (ROM) for continuous outcomes and bias-corrected odds ratios for dichotomous outcomes. RESULTS: Of 646 studies identified 175 met inclusion criteria. In the PBP studies (n&#x2009;=&#x2009;18), 94% fulfilled minimum criteria (use of a proficiency benchmark, its quantitative definition, and requirement for demonstration prior to progression) vs 36% of non-PBP studies (n&#x2009;=&#x2009;157). If all PBP criteria were included, 83% of PBP studies used these criteria vs only 2% of non-PBP-studies. In quantitative analysis (27 randomised clinical studies, 761 participants), ROM results showed that PBP training reduced the number of performance errors by 58% (P&#x2009;<&#x2009;0.001) and procedural time by 28% (P&#x2009;=&#x2009;0.006), increasing number of steps performed by 22% (P&#x2009;=&#x2009;0.03). When stratified based on number of criteria fulfilled, meta-regression demonstrated that increasing the number of PBP criteria fulfilled was associated with progressive and systematic trainee performance improvement. CONCLUSIONS: The more training methodologies adhere to established PBP criteria, the better training outcome will be.

Associations Between Short Video Exposure, Empathy and Attitudes Toward End-Of-Life Care Among Nursing Students: A Cross-Sectional Study.

AIM: This cross-sectional study examined the associations between short video exposure, nursing students' empathy, and attitudes toward end-of-life (EOL) care, and tested whether perceived impact is statistically consistent with an indirect pathway in these relationships. DESIGN: A descriptive cross-sectional study. METHODS: In total, 534 undergraduate nursing students were included. Data were collected using a self-designed questionnaire, including the Attitudes Toward Care of the Dying Scale and the Jefferson Scale of Empathy-Health Professions Student version for empathy assessment. Statistical analysis for correlation and mediation analysis (PROCESS macro) was performed. RESULTS: 85.96% of students watch short videos for more than 30&#x2009;min daily, with more than 60% of them viewing EOL-related content. Students with prior caregiving experience or formal palliative care education showed significantly higher empathy and more positive attitudes (p&#x2009;<&#x2009;0.05). Exposure to medical and EOL-related short videos was positively correlated with perceived impact, empathy, and positive EOL attitudes, with effect sizes ranging from very weak to modest (r&#x2009;=&#x2009;0.10 to 0.27). The data were consistent with an indirect pathway between short video exposure and empathy via perceived impact (indirect effect&#x2009;=&#x2009;0.04; 95% bootstrap CI [0.01, 0.08]). However, for EOL attitudes, short video exposure showed a direct association rather than an indirect pathway via perceived impact (direct effect&#x2009;=&#x2009;0.09, p&#x2009;<&#x2009;0.01). CONCLUSION: In this cross-sectional study, short video exposure was modestly associated with nursing students' empathy, with data consistent with an indirect pathway via perceived impact; the observed associations explained only approximately 1% to 7% of the variance in the outcome variables. However, reshaping EOL attitudes may require more systematic education beyond brief video exposure. These findings are hypothesis-generating and await validation through longitudinal and experimental research using standardized video content. IMPLICATIONS FOR NURSING PRACTICE: Nursing educators should consider integrating curated short video content into palliative care curricula to enhance students' empathy and perceived impact of end-of-life education. However, brief video exposure alone may be insufficient to reshape deeper end-of-life attitudes, suggesting the need for comprehensive, multi-modal educational strategies.
